What is Sports Therapy?

Sports therapy is a physical therapy sub-speciality built around the objective of preventing injuries, maximizing fitness and performance, and rehabilitation athletes following an acute or chronic injury. The sports therapist works closely with the athlete to return the patient to their peak performance level so they can safely get back to their sport. Patients participating in Jefferson Barracks, MO sports therapy typically begin after experiencing an acute injury, after receiving surgery, or when addressing overuse injuries that make it difficult or painful to participate in their usual activities.

Sports therapy is the convergence of the principles of sport and exercise science with the primary objectives of optimizing movement, improving athletic performance, and recovering from injury. It is practiced and administered by physical therapists and certified strength and conditioning specialists who apply their knowledge, skills, and abilities in evidence-based therapeutic practices to treat athletes. These professionals have trained and worked extensively in treating athletes, both amateur and professional, and are authorities in musculoskeletal rehabilitation. Sports therapy places a focus on rehabilitation, treatment, prevention, and education.

We treat Jefferson Barracks, MO sports therapy patients for many different reasons. The most common sports-related injuries, according to the National Institute of Health are:

  • Sprains and strains
  • Knee injuries
  • Swollen muscles
  • Sort tissue injuries
  • Achilles tendon injuries
  • Shin splints and shin pain
  • Rotator cuff injuries
  • Broken bones (simple and compound fractures)
  • Joint dislocations

There is always a risk of injuries like those listed above when one engages in physical activity. However, the risk increases for someone who is not in good physical shape or anyone who participates in physical activity without simple precautions. The risk of injury is dramatically less when you properly prepare before playing. Prior to engaging in strenuous physical activity or playing a sport, always stretch and warm up. Ongoing strength and flexibility training also helps you avoid getting hurt. Additionally, using the proper technique and appropriate safety equipment for any sport reduces the chances of serious injury. Even the world’s top athletes are prone to injury when they push themselves too far, playing without the proper rest or before allowing their current injuries the necessary recovery time.

Still, sometimes injuries happen even in the most careful situations. When this happens, reacting to the injury correctly is key in reducing the impact of the injury and managing its effect. It’s important to know what to do immediately after an acute injury. Often, the best thing to do is to stop playing. Do not try to play through it, even if you believe the injury to be minor. Most of the time, the first step in treatment is the RICE method, which stands for rest, ice, compression, and elevation. It will alleviate pain, minimize swelling, and speed up the healing process.
